We are seeking an experienced High Voltage Maintenance Delivery Manager to be based either at our Oxford, Maple Lodge, Basingstoke or Hampton Treatment Works, depending on your location.
As the successful candidate, you will lead a team of Electrical Engineers/Senior Authorised Persons, providing operation, maintenance, and fault-finding activities on high voltage and primary low voltage systems. This includes overall responsibility to ensure the proper installation, construction, commissioning, and handover of significant electrical assets, in accordance with TWUL asset standards.
Thames Water operates a substantial network of high voltage (HV) and low voltage (LV) electrical power systems, which are vital to water production and waste treatment for our 16 million customers.
Maintaining the safe and reliable operation of these assets requires extensive knowledge of electrical technology, safety procedures, and providing expert support to operational teams. The teams involved in frontline operation and maintenance need ongoing technical support for maintenance, fault investigation, asset upgrades, and incident analysis.
This role demands regular engagement with stakeholders from Operations, Engineering, Capital Delivery, and Health Safety and Wellbeing functions.
